B.E./B.Tech, Anjuman College of Engineering and Technology (ACET), Nagpur charges approximate INR 3,46,000 for the whole course according to branches in Computer Science, Mechanical, Electrical, and Electronics & Telecommunication Engineering. So, additional charges may apply at times with some specific courses. The admissions in this course are done through entrance exams like JEE Main and MHT CET, and it is affiliated with Rashtrasant Tukadoji Maharaj Nagpur University. One must consult the college for the current fee structure.

At Saroj Institute of Technology and Management (SITM), the annual fee for a B.Tech programme is around INR 1,00,000 for the regular mode. For students opting for the global mode, which offers international exposure, the fee is about INR1,50,000 per year.

The fees charged for B.E./B.Tech in Lucknow Institute of Technology are almost between INR 1,00,000-INR 1,50,000 per annum, which includes tuition fees, registration fees, and fees for examinations. Thus the total cost for four-year course would be approximately around INR 4,00,000 to INR 6,00,000 for a period of four years. Additional expenses will be hostel fees at around INR 45,000 per annum. The personal expenses for books and materials will also come into the picture. Thus, LIT has an attractive fee structure compared to most other engineering colleges in the region.

The fee for the B.E. / B.Tech programme at PCET varies according to the course and category. On an average, the annual fee for government quota students runs into INR 50,000 to INR 60,000. For management quota students, the fees are higher. All the above fees include registration fees, exam fees, and other such services. For the exact and updated fee details, one can check on the official website of PCET or contact the college directly as fees tend to change every year due to guidelines from Anna University and government regulations.

The B.E./B.Tech fees at Bapuji Institute of Engineering and Technology vary according to the programme and admission category. Students admitted through the KCET (Karnataka Common Entrance Test) pay relatively lower fees whereas those admitted through COMEDK or management quota pay comparatively higher fees. The estimated annual amount for Karnataka students is within the range of INR 70,000 to INR 90,000; for COMEDK students, it starts from INR 1.2 Lacs per year and goes up to INR 1.5 Lacs per year. The fees for B.E./B.Tech programs at Babu Banarasi Das National Institute of Technology and Management generally range between INR 1,00,000 and INR 1,50,000 per year. This comprises tuition fees, registration fees, exam fees, and other academic charges. Extra charges may be applicable, such as hostel fees depending on the type of accommodation, laboratory fees, and extracurricular activity costs. The fee schedule is only slightly different, depending upon the programme or academic year, so this information might be best located on their official website, or call the admissions office for updates.
